Lise‐Lotte Fernström is a scholar working on Food Science, Biotechnology and Infectious Diseases. According to data from OpenAlex, Lise‐Lotte Fernström has authored 20 papers receiving a total of 439 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Food Science, 6 papers in Biotechnology and 6 papers in Infectious Diseases. Recurrent topics in Lise‐Lotte Fernström’s work include Salmonella and Campylobacter epidemiology (13 papers), Listeria monocytogenes in Food Safety (6 papers) and Viral gastroenteritis research and epidemiology (4 papers). Lise‐Lotte Fernström is often cited by papers focused on Salmonella and Campylobacter epidemiology (13 papers), Listeria monocytogenes in Food Safety (6 papers) and Viral gastroenteritis research and epidemiology (4 papers). Lise‐Lotte Fernström collaborates with scholars based in Sweden, Cambodia and Thailand. Lise‐Lotte Fernström's co-authors include Ingrid Hansson, Sofia Boqvist, Gunilla Trowald‐Wigh, Ulf Magnusson, Karel Krovacek, Sara Frosth, Karl‐Erik Johansson, Beatrix Alsanius, C. Fred Bergsten and Sokerya Seng and has published in prestigious journals such as International Journal of Food Microbiology, Journal of Applied Microbiology and Food Control.
